Studying in a heart of Prague

As a freshman at UNYP, I really appreciate the way the university teachers approach students—they are approachable, supportive, and genuinely engaged in our learning. The building is modern and conveniently located in the city, which makes attending classes enjoyable. The classes themselves are attentive and interesting, making it a great environment to start my university journey.

Erasmus experience

I have spent one semester here thanks to the Erasmus exchange programme and I can honestly say that it was the greatest semester I have spent in the last 2 years as a student. The facilities are modern, friendly and can be easily used. The buildings of the university are placed in quiet and easily accessible places. The teachers are open-minded, kind, friendly, they do not behave in a superior manner. The university also pays attention to student life, they organize meetings and student afternoons. Not to forget all the opportunities Prague is giving you, starting with interesting events, conferences, workshops as well as entertainment.

encourage to study in charles university

My name is Bashar Ali, I am a medicine student in the first year. Today I am going to share my experience in Charles university. As a new student I was confused at the beginning of the year but after not long time I got used to the university system and the university stuff was very helpful starting from professional and nice teachers and ending with office employees. For me the academic side was perfect and my experience was very good. The university provide us with valuable information and we can find a lot of different students from different parts of the world so we can meet people from different cultures. I lived in the dorms and for me it was good because it was safe, clean and cheap. Now I am very happy in my studies especially that the university degree is recognized all over the world in addition that it is one of the highest ranking in the world in conclusion, Charles University offers a world-class medical education that combines rigorous academics, exceptional clinical training, and abundant research opportunities
